A line has a slope of -3/5. Through which two points could the line pass?

(-4,-1) and (3,20)

(8,1) and (13,4)

(-16,-4) and (12,8)

(-5,9) and (10,0)

for example

(0-9) / (10 - -5) = -9/+15 = -3/5

The two points through which the line could pass are (-5,9) and (10,0).
